available from Wikipedia or other free sources online. Brian McKeever
(born June 18, 1979 in Calgary, Alberta) is a Canadian cross-country
skier and biathlete. He began skiing at the age of three and started
competing at thirteen. At 19 he began losing his vision due to
Stargardt's disease. At the 2002 and 2006 Winter Paralympics he competed
in both cross-country skiing and biathlon. He won two gold medals and a
silver in cross-country the first year and bronze medal for biathlon
plus two gold medals and a silver for cross-country skiing in the later
year. His older brother, Robin McKeever, competes as his guide when
Brian skis in the Paralympics.
